I have just purchased a new GUI or Dexterit-E Computer.  How do I transfer a MATLAB license to my new Dexterit-E Computer?

Transferring a MATLAB license depends on the license type. If it is a site license (i.e. that the university owns and manages, then you will have to contact them). If it is an individual license, then it is done through that MathWorks website. You have to log in to your MathWorks account and select the correct License (i.e. you may have more than one license for your lab). Then you can click on the Install and Activate tab. It will list the various computers that the license has been activated for. Individual licenses can have up to 4 activations. You will want to deactivate the one for the old PC (the Activation labels are MAC IDs – go to the command prompt and type ipconfig to see that various MAC addresses for the computer).   You will then have to install MATLAB on the new PC and follow the instructions that MATLAB provides for activating the new computer. Be sure to follow the various instructions in our Creating Task Programs Guide for setting up MATLAB correctly.
